composer拉取指定版本

背景

有时我们在项目开发中,需要拉取一些composer的第三方包,比如说:predis 。但是,有时,predis支持的PHP的版本或者支持laravel的版本有一定的要求,这时,我们需要拉取适用项目的版本。

获取指定版本命令总结

  • 方法一
composer require "illuminate/redis:5.5.*" #拉取适合项目的5.5系列的版本
  • 方法二
composer require "predis/predis:^1.1" #适用^符号,表示相当于 >=1.1 且  < 2.0
  • 方法三
composer require "foo/bar:1.0.0" #拉取特定版本1.0.0
  • 方法四
    在项目的composer.json的require中设置,然后执行composer install
{
        "require": {
                "monolog/monolog":"1.19"
        }
}

备注

更多摩尔小哥的源著作品,搜索:http://www.51about.com

你可能感兴趣的:(PHP,php,laravel)